Rival gangs battle for control of the black market liquor business in 1920s Chicago.

Each round, players spin, deal, talk and fight to control where they buy and sell liquor, help politicians get elected and get help in return or double-cross rival gangs.

In Wise Guys, negotiate, threaten and ally with rival gangs when it serves your needs, but beware of the inevitable knife in the back...

Over the course of six rounds, players take turns driving to locations in the city represented by the grid of cards in the center of the board.

Different locations provide access to materials, money, or influence that the player's gang members can acquire by trading, profiting from ownership in their territory, or exploiting parts of the city under the control of a rival gang. All players must maintain some discretion, as selling too much in one round will attract unwanted attention or saturate the city with alcohol - and your fellow mobster won't be too happy about the lost profits.

The gang with the most money at the end of the game wins.
